WordPress 定制開發(fā)常用錯誤有哪些?如何預防WordPress 的開發(fā)錯誤?網(wǎng)站停機令人沮喪,但WordPress 顯示錯誤是有充分理由的。然而,好消息是大多數(shù)常見的 WordPress 錯誤都是由相同的問題和錯誤配置引起的,因此相對容易排除故障。北京六翼的開發(fā)工程師針對WordPress 定制開發(fā)常用錯誤和預防的問題給大家科普一下。

大多數(shù)情況下,WordPress 錯誤是由您網(wǎng)站環(huán)境的以下關(guān)鍵組件之一的錯誤配置引起的:
l 關(guān)鍵的WordPress 配置
l PHP環(huán)境
l HTTP/Web 服務器配置(Apache、Litespeed、NGINX 等)
l WordPress插件
安全問題也可能導致網(wǎng)站被黑或感染惡意軟件,從而產(chǎn)生錯誤或?qū)е?/span>WordPress 網(wǎng)站癱瘓。
關(guān)鍵的 WordPress 配置
WordPress 依賴于網(wǎng)站所有者提供的關(guān)鍵配置。此信息存儲在WordPress 主配置文件 wp-config.php和WordPress 數(shù)據(jù)庫的 wp_options 表中。它必須始終存在并且正確。它包括數(shù)據(jù)庫連接詳細信息——數(shù)據(jù)庫用戶、密碼、數(shù)據(jù)庫主機、站點地址和 WordPress 的位置,以及其他信息,例如 WordPress 鹽和安全密鑰。
PHP安裝
使用的PHP 版本必須與您網(wǎng)站的WordPress 核心版本完全兼容,并安裝了所需的PHP 擴展。最重要的是,關(guān)鍵的 PHP 限制,例如 PHP 內(nèi)存限制、最長執(zhí)行時間和最大上傳文件大小,必須設置得足夠高才能讓您的網(wǎng)站正常運行,尤其是當您有資源密集型主題或插件時.
網(wǎng)絡服務器配置
HTTP Web 服務器配置用于設置永久網(wǎng)站重定向和安裝SSL/TLS 證書以保持Web 流量加密。Apache 和 Litespeed HTTP 服務器使用 WordPress 安裝文件夾中的.htaccess文件作為本地配置文件,告訴Web 服務器如何處理到達您網(wǎng)站的請求。它包括您網(wǎng)站的永久鏈接結(jié)構(gòu)和您的重定向路徑。其他常見的HTTP 服務器都有自己類似的配置文件,例如 NGINX 的 nginx.conf。
活動插件
WordPress 插件通過擴展平臺的本機功能在WordPress 生態(tài)系統(tǒng)中發(fā)揮著巨大的作用。但是,新插件會增加網(wǎng)站的復雜性,并且通常會增加服務器數(shù)據(jù)庫、內(nèi)存和CPU 資源的負載。不兼容的插件或與插件的主題沖突會產(chǎn)生錯誤,并可能導致您的站點停機。
網(wǎng)站安全
保護您的網(wǎng)站免受攻擊者的侵害始終是重中之重。WordPress 網(wǎng)站安全性中的任何缺陷都會導致黑客破壞關(guān)鍵 WordPress 功能的可能性,這可能會導致嚴重錯誤和停機。
如果像WordPress 這樣的服務器或 Web 應用程序受到威脅并且黑客更改了關(guān)鍵文件、數(shù)據(jù)庫信息或文件權(quán)限,這可能會導致致命的WordPress 錯誤。
確保您使用最好的安全解決方案來保護您的WordPress 網(wǎng)站免受不斷演變的安全威脅。iThemes Security Pro提供30 種保護 WordPress 網(wǎng)站關(guān)鍵區(qū)域的方法,包括高級漏洞掃描、文件完整性監(jiān)控和無密碼身份驗證。
如果您還有關(guān)于WordPress 定制開發(fā)的問題歡迎留言探討。





